Clarksville, TN vs Portland, OR
Cost of Living Comparison
Clarksville, TN is more affordable by 14.5 index points
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Category | Clarksville, TN | Portland, OR |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all | 90.9 | 105.4 | -14.5 |
| Housing | 73.8 | 125.1 | -51.3 |
| Goods | 96.2 | 105.2 | -9.0 |
| Utilities | 72.5 | 107.0 | -34.4 |
| Other Services | 95.5 | 100.1 | -4.6 |
Income & Housing Comparison
| Metric | Clarksville, TN | Portland, OR |
|---|---|---|
| Median Household Income | $62,188 | $90,451 |
| Median Home Value | $208,200 | $484,800 |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,064 | $1,577 |
| Per Capita Income | $30,021 | $47,649 |
